当前位置: 首页 > 专利查询>黄山学院专利>正文

一种两轮自平衡移动机器人控制系统技术方案

技术编号:22802924 阅读:21 留言:0更新日期:2019-12-11 12:37
本实用新型专利技术公开了一种两轮自平衡移动机器人控制系统,包括有安装在两轮自平衡移动机器人内部的主控芯片以及与主控芯片连接的电源、速度测量传感器、轨道循迹传感器、参数调整模块和电机驱动模块,还包括有安装在两轮自平衡移动机器人底部的与主控芯片连接的倾角测量传感器和安装在两轮自平衡移动机器人上的与主控芯片连接的显示模块和蓝牙信息接收采集模块,倾角测量传感器包括有加速度计和陀螺仪,加速度计和陀螺仪采集的数据通过数据融合单元发送给主控芯片,所述的轨道循迹传感器是由工字型电感构成的,所述的电机驱动模块还与两轮自平衡移动机器人内部的驱动电机连接。本实用新型专利技术采用多传感器的信息融合,可以得到更加准确的测量数据。

A control system of two wheeled self balancing mobile robot

The utility model discloses a control system of a two wheel self balancing mobile robot, which comprises a main control chip installed inside the two wheel self balancing mobile robot, a power supply connected with the main control chip, a speed measurement sensor, a track tracking sensor, a parameter adjustment module and an electric drive module, and a main control chip installed at the bottom of the two wheel self balancing mobile robot The connected inclinometer sensor and the display module and the Bluetooth information receiving and collecting module connected with the main control chip installed on the two wheel self balancing mobile robot, the inclinometer sensor includes an accelerometer and a gyroscope, and the data collected by the accelerometer and the gyroscope are sent to the main control chip through a data fusion unit, and the track tracking sensor is constructed by an i-type inductance The motor driving module is also connected with the driving motor inside the two-wheel self balancing mobile robot. The utility model adopts multi-sensor information fusion, which can obtain more accurate measurement data.

【技术实现步骤摘要】
一种两轮自平衡移动机器人控制系统
本技术涉及机器人控制
,尤其涉及一种两轮自平衡移动机器人控制系统。
技术介绍
两轮自平衡移动机器人为典型的非完整、非线性及欠驱动控制系统,具有广泛的实际应用价值。为了实现该系统运动过程中的平衡控制,必须具有能够实时检测其姿态信息的检测系统,并将姿态信息及时传递给控制器,以实现对两轮自平衡移动机器人的准确控制。目前,用于两轮自平衡移动机器人控制的角度传感器和陀螺仪都有缺点,容易受外界的影响,造成测量的不准,影响控制精度。
技术实现思路
本技术目的就是为了弥补已有技术的缺陷,提供一种两轮自平衡移动机器人控制系统。本技术是通过以下技术方案实现的:一种两轮自平衡移动机器人控制系统,包括有安装在两轮自平衡移动机器人内部的主控芯片以及与主控芯片连接的电源、速度测量传感器、轨道循迹传感器、参数调整模块和电机驱动模块,还包括有安装在两轮自平衡移动机器人底部的与主控芯片连接的倾角测量传感器和安装在两轮自平衡移动机器人上的与主控芯片连接的显示模块和蓝牙信息接收采集模块,所述的倾角测量传感器包括有加速度计和陀螺仪,加速度计和陀螺仪采集的数据通过数据融合单元发送给主控芯片,所述的轨道循迹传感器是由工字型电感构成的,所述的电机驱动模块还与两轮自平衡移动机器人内部的驱动电机连接。所述的主控芯片采用S9KEA128AMLK芯片。所述的加速度计的型号为MMA845X;所述的陀螺仪的型号为L3G4200。所述的速度测量传感器采用mini512线编码器。r>所述的电机驱动模块是采用MOS管搭建的全桥驱动。所述的参数调整模块是由键盘和拨码开关构成的。所述的倾角测量传感器由安装在两轮自平衡移动机器人底部的加速度计和陀螺仪构成,加速度计和陀螺仪所采集的数据经数据融合单元的处理,从而获得更加准确的采集数据;所述的轨道循迹传感器由电感构成,通过对通电导线周边所产生磁场的采集,算出中线使两轮自平衡移动机器人沿着中线运动;所述的速度测量传感器采用mini512线编码器实现,用于采集两轮自平衡移动机器人的运动速度信息;所述的蓝牙信息接收模块,用于将主控芯片接收的信息发送给上位机,同时上位机也可以发送两轮自平衡移动机器人的控制命令到主控芯片;所述的电机驱动模块MOS管搭建的全桥电路构成,其输出信号用于控制两轮自平衡移动机器人驱动轮的动作;系统所述电源由7.2V锂电池构成;所述参数调整模块由键盘和拨码开个构成,主要用于对控制系统运行的PID算法的相关参数进行设定。对于加速度计传感器容易受电机电压信号的干扰,造成测量数据毛刺太多,不利于控制。陀螺仪测量角速度,需要通过积分运算,但积分运算容易造成滞后,两者经过角度融合,各取所长得去最后的角度。本技术的优点是:本技术采用多传感器的信息融合,可以得到更加准确的测量数据;两轮自平衡移动机器人不同与其它四轮机器人,它靠两个轮子行走,所以在机械结构方面自然要求严格一点了;首先要知道机械零点这个点;没有机械零点的机器人,意味永远无法通过加减速达到平衡状态;另外机器人的重量集中在轴的两侧,这样方便回到平衡状态,机器人的重量比较偏轻,省去了调整所需花费的动力,方便行走。附图说明图1为本技术系统构成框图。图2为本技术各个模块的供电电源电路图。图3为本技术的电机驱动模块电路图。图4为本技术参数调整模块的电路图。图5为本技术ADC数据采集口的电路图。图6为本技术倾角传感器模块的电路图。图7为本技术显示模块模块的电路图。图8为本技术蓝牙串口模块的电路图。图9为本技术速度测量模块的电路图。具体实施方式如图1、2所示,一种两轮自平衡移动机器人控制系统,包括有安装在两轮自平衡移动机器人内部的主控芯片1以及与主控芯片1连接的电源2、速度测量传感器4、轨道循迹传感器5、参数调整模块6和电机驱动模块9,还包括有安装在两轮自平衡移动机器人底部的与主控芯片1连接的倾角测量传感器3和安装在两轮自平衡移动机器人上的与主控芯片1连接的显示模块7和蓝牙信息接收采集模块8,所述的倾角测量传感器3包括有加速度计和陀螺仪,加速度计和陀螺仪采集的数据通过数据融合单元发送给主控芯片,所述的轨道循迹传感器5是由工字型电感构成的,所述的电机驱动模块9还与两轮自平衡移动机器人内部的驱动电机连接。所述的主控芯片1采用S9KEA128AMLK芯片,该芯片自带12位ADC采集功能,PWM控制精确。所述的加速度计的型号为MMA845X;所述的陀螺仪的型号为L3G4200。所述的速度测量传感器4采用mini512线编码器。如图3所示,所述的电机驱动模块9是采用MOS管搭建的全桥驱动,具有驱动电流更大,驱动效果好的特点。所述的参数调整模块6是由键盘和拨码开关构成的。所述的倾角采集模块3由安装在两轮自平衡移动机器人底部的加速度计和陀螺仪构成,加速度计和陀螺仪所采集的数据经数据融合单元的处理,从而获得更加准确的采集数据;所述的轨道循迹传感器5由工字型电感构成,通过对通电导线周边所产生磁场的采集,算出中线使两轮自平衡移动机器人沿着中线运动;所述的速度测量传感器4采用mini512线编码器实现,用于采集两轮自平衡移动机器人的运动速度信息;所述的蓝牙信息接收模块,用于将主控芯片接收的信息发送给上位机,同时上位机也可以发送两轮自平衡移动机器人的控制命令到主控芯片;所述的电机驱动模块9MOS管搭建的全桥电路构成,其输出信号用于控制两轮自平衡移动机器人驱动轮的动作;所述电源由7.2V锂电池构成;如图4、5所示,所述参数调整模块由键盘和拨码开个构成,主要用于对控制系统运行的PID算法的相关参数进行设定。如图5、6、7、8、9所示,分别为ADC数据采集口的电路图、倾角传感器模块的电路图、显示模块模块的电路图、蓝牙串口模块的电路图、速度测量模块的电路图。为了得到更好的控制效果,本技术采用了速度--角度--角速度三级由外到内的串级控制方法,采用串级控制方案的优点有:1)由于副回路的存在,减小了对象的时间常数,缩短了控制通道,使控制作用能得到更加及时的响应。2)使两轮自平衡移动机器人控制系统具有更好的抗干扰能力。3)使两轮自平衡移动机器人对其负荷或者运行环境的变化具有一定的自适应能力。对两轮自平衡移动机器人的控制具体包括三个方面的控制:一、两轮自平衡移动机器人直立控制利用倾角测量传感器读出数据,进行卡尔曼滤波处理得到最终的角度信息。在两轮自平衡移动机器人的直立控制中,角速度环和角度环都使用PD控制算法,通过该算法可以做到两轮自平衡移动机器人直立的控制要求。二、两轮自平衡移动机器人行走控制为了获得两轮自平衡移动机器人速度,本实用信息采用mini512线编码器进行速度检测,两轮自平衡移动机本文档来自技高网...

【技术保护点】
1.一种两轮自平衡移动机器人控制系统,其特征在于:包括有安装在两轮自平衡移动机器人内部的主控芯片以及与主控芯片连接的电源、速度测量传感器、轨道循迹传感器、参数调整模块和电机驱动模块,还包括有安装在两轮自平衡移动机器人底部的与主控芯片连接的倾角测量传感器和安装在两轮自平衡移动机器人上的与主控芯片连接的显示模块和蓝牙信息接收采集模块,所述的倾角测量传感器包括有加速度计和陀螺仪,加速度计和陀螺仪采集的数据通过数据融合单元发送给主控芯片,所述的轨道循迹传感器是由工字型电感构成的,所述的电机驱动模块还与两轮自平衡移动机器人内部的驱动电机连接。/n

【技术特征摘要】
1.一种两轮自平衡移动机器人控制系统,其特征在于:包括有安装在两轮自平衡移动机器人内部的主控芯片以及与主控芯片连接的电源、速度测量传感器、轨道循迹传感器、参数调整模块和电机驱动模块,还包括有安装在两轮自平衡移动机器人底部的与主控芯片连接的倾角测量传感器和安装在两轮自平衡移动机器人上的与主控芯片连接的显示模块和蓝牙信息接收采集模块,所述的倾角测量传感器包括有加速度计和陀螺仪,加速度计和陀螺仪采集的数据通过数据融合单元发送给主控芯片,所述的轨道循迹传感器是由工字型电感构成的,所述的电机驱动模块还与两轮自平衡移动机器人内部的驱动电机连接。


2.根据权利要求1所述的一种两轮自平衡移动机器人控制系统,其特征在于:所...

【专利技术属性】
技术研发人员:郭一军黄辉倪康
申请(专利权)人:黄山学院
类型:新型
国别省市:安徽;34

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1